Decoding the Secure Crossword Puzzle Clue

When you see a clue related to “secure,” think broadly about its various meanings. It could refer to a physical object that provides safety, like a lock or a safe. It could also refer to an emotional state of feeling protected or a verb describing the act of making something safe. Consider all the angles!

Synonyms are your best friend! Brainstorm words that mean safe, protected, guarded, or locked. Think of words like “fortified,” “immune,” or “anchored.” A thesaurus can be a real game-changer here. Don’t be afraid to explore less obvious synonyms the puzzle creator might be getting creative!

Consider the context of the clue. What’s the theme of the crossword? Is it related to finance, technology, or maybe even mythology? The theme can offer valuable hints about the specific type of security being referenced. Often the shorter the answer, the more abstract the answer can be.

Look for common crosswordese related to security. For example, “vault” is a frequent answer for clues about secure storage. “Guard” is another common word that appears often. Recognizing these common answers will help you solve related clues more efficiently and with confidence.

Pay close attention to the clue’s wording and any abbreviations. “Secure (abbr.)” would indicate a shorter answer. The presence of “is” or “was” might hint that the answer is a synonym and not a direct definition. Little details like these can make a big difference in getting the right answer.
